Family Medicine Physician Assistant
Seeking a dedicated and compassionate Physician Assistant to join our family medicine team of five physicians. This role offers an excellent opportunity to provide comprehensive healthcare services in a collaborative, supportive and patient centered environment. The ideal candidate will be committed to delivering high-quality health care and build lasting relationship with patients of all ages.
Key Responsibilities:
- Take medical histories, and perform physical assessments
- Diagnose and treat a variety of acute and chronic illnesses within the scope of family medicine
- Order, interpret, and evaluate diagnostic tests and laboratory results
- Develop and implement personalized treatment plans in collaboration with supervising physicians
- Provide patient education on health maintenance, disease prevention, and management of chronic conditions
- Perform basic medical procedures (Cryo, Skin Bx, I&D, etc.) If qualified.
- Document patient encounters accurately and maintain detailed medical records
- Collaborate with healthcare team members to ensure coordinated and comprehensive patient care
